Sankey diagrams are a visual representation of flow between entities, allowing the depiction and comparison of the size and direction of these flows. The unique design of these diagrams includes various components such as the nodes or endpoints, which symbolize different categories, and the links between them, which indicate the connections and flows. This intricate layout makes it easier to understand the magnitude and direction of flows, thereby highlighting patterns that might otherwise be obscured within raw data.
This graphical representation brings to light an insightful tool for diverse fields. In environmental studies, for instance, Sankey diagrams can vividly visualize the sources and fates of pollutants, enhancing our understanding of these complex flows. They are instrumental in urban planning as well, where they can be used to illustrate traffic patterns, public transportation usage, and the movement of pedestrian traffic. This clarity in representation makes it easier for policymakers and urban planners to implement effective strategies.
Sankey diagrams, when utilized in business intelligence, can further aid in elucidating supply chains, customer behavior patterns, and transaction flows. By providing a clear, comprehensive view of various processes, decision makers are empowered to identify bottlenecks, optimize resources, and make data-driven decisions.
